A Decade of Innovation: Asygma's Role in Connecting Amazon Lockers Across Europe

Parcel Delivery with Amazon Lockers

In the pioneering days of Amazon's locker test program in Seattle, USA, the e-commerce giant eyed expansion into the UK and Europe. Enter Asygma (formerly London Web), chosen as the connectivity partner to bring these lockers online with a seamless solution. 

CHALLENGE

The task was monumental. Thousands of lockers needed a secure connection to Amazon's Seattle headquarters. The challenge was compounded by the necessity for a static IP address for command and control, something unattainable through the then 3G connectivity. These lockers, destined for diverse locations including petrol stations, demanded 24/7 availability, stringent SLAs, and rapid response times. The operational complexity was further heightened by occasional computer malfunctions requiring physical reboots, potentially disrupting service. 

CLIENT NEEDS

Amazon's requirements were stringent: 

  • Exclusive locker access for authorized Amazon personnel. 

  • Consistently available and resilient connectivity. 

  • Efficient logistics for precise connectivity kit distribution. 

  • Unprecedentedly high security standards, surpassing NIST and ISO27001 norms, entailing multiple complex security layers. 

OUR SOLUTION

Asygma's approach was multifaceted: 

  • Establishing a 24/7 global support team, complete with training.

  • Development of a service portal and KPI dashboard for secure, role-based access to operational reports, fleet visualization, and command issuance.

  • Introduction of 3G power-breakers to remotely reboot devices.

  • Tailored connectivity solutions for distribution centers and local 3G provider integration in France, Germany, and Spain.

  • Implementation of advanced monitoring systems with self-healing mechanisms, capable of preemptive issue detection and automated remediation.

  • Pioneering a method to determine the most effective network for each locker location, a necessity in the absence of multi-network SIM cards or e-SIM technology.

  • Developing a training and methodology system for regional engineers to efficiently manage and replace equipment, reducing downtime.

  • Strategic negotiations to secure cost-effective equipment pricing, outperforming Amazon's own estimates.

The rollout was methodical: 

  • A pilot phase with 10 lockers in key London locations.

  • Expansion to 20 lockers with redesigned solutions.

  • Resolution of computer freezing and 3G connectivity issues through additional equipment and advanced logistics.

  • Continuous rapid development and improvements.
